Biography
Pier Angeli (19 June 1932 – 10 September 1971), also credited under her real name, Anna Maria Pierangeli, was an Italian-born film and television actress, singer, and model, who starred in American, British, and European films throughout her career. Her American motion picture debut was in the starring role of the film Teresa (1951), for which she won a Golden Globe Award for Young Star of the Year - Actress. Besides this film, she is best remembered for her roles in, Domani è troppo tardi (1950), Somebody Up There Likes Me (1956) and The Angry Silence (1960).
